RE: AV Noob; newer audiophile - PreAmp purchase help

I would go for a Marantz 7005, or 8003, or such preamp used... does HDMI switching, MM Phono input, tuner built in, remote, ...

OR for better sound, something like the Parasound Halo P5 - meets all your criteria and it throws a pretty decent stage...

If you do not need a remote - look into a Used Audible Illusions M3a(audioasylumtrader, or US Audio Mart, Agon if you have to...). That sounds way better than either above, has tubes, and would be around your $1k budget used. Nice large stage... Also something like Blue Circle's BC3 preamps used as a deal and a half, no phono built in, but is future proof, as Gilbert can always add/upgrade to meet your setups needs. Same $1k ball park used. best sounding/staging unit of those listed here by a large margin...
